Introduction: An Authentic Vietnamese Cooking Experience in Hanoi

A private Vietnamese cooking class in Hanoi with a local host offers a rare glimpse into the heart of northern Vietnam’s culinary traditions. Priced at $74 per person and lasting about three hours, this experience takes you directly into a Hanoi family home, where Maia warmly welcomes you to learn her favorite recipes. You’ll spend around 1.5 to 2 hours actively cooking, then sit down to enjoy the fruits of your labor alongside some pre-prepared dishes.

What we love about this experience is how it blends personal hospitality with culinary education—a true insider’s look into Vietnamese home cooking. The chance to cook 2-3 seasonal dishes from scratch is invaluable, offering not just a meal but a skill set you can recreate back home. Plus, sharing a meal in Maia’s home creates a friendly, genuine atmosphere that many larger classes can’t match.

A possible consideration is transportation—since the tour doesn’t include it, you’ll need to arrange your own way to Maia’s home. The Experience in Detail

Meeting Maia and Setting the Scene

Your journey begins with meeting Maia at her Hanoi home, a cozy and tidy space that feels welcoming from the start. The reviews highlight Maia’s warm personality—she’s described as “lovely,” “knowledgeable,” and “witty,” which makes the entire experience more engaging. Maia’s home provides a comfortable backdrop, free from the noise and chaos of busy streets, giving you a peaceful environment to learn and cook.

The Market Visit and Ingredient Selection

While not explicitly detailed in the provided info, some reviews mention Maia’s willingness to take you to her local market, a valuable part of understanding Vietnamese cuisine. Visiting a market lets you see the fresh ingredients—herbs, vegetables, spices—that make Vietnamese dishes so distinctive. It’s a chance to ask questions about ingredient choices and see how Vietnamese cooks select their produce.

The Cooking Lesson

The core of the experience is Maia teaching you how to make 2 authentic Vietnamese dishes from scratch. The lesson lasts about 1.5 to 2 hours. During this time, you’ll learn techniques that turn simple ingredients into flavorful dishes—think fragrant herbs, balanced sauces, and quick stir-fries or noodle dishes. One reviewer called the food “exceptional and easy to replicate,” which suggests Maia’s teaching style is clear and approachable.

The dishes are seasonal, which means they reflect what’s fresh and available during your visit—an important detail that ensures meals are flavorful and true to local tastes. Maia shares her personal favorites, giving you a taste of her cultural background and culinary preferences.

The Meal and Conversation

After cooking, you’ll sit down at Maia’s dining table to enjoy your creations. The meal includes appetizers, main courses, and desserts, providing a well-rounded introduction to Vietnamese flavors. Many reviews mention how delicious and “incredible” the food is, emphasizing that the dishes are both authentic and easy to recreate at home.

What makes this part special is the relaxed, personal setting—your host is genuinely interested in sharing stories and answering questions. This interaction turns a simple cooking class into a memorable cultural exchange.
